Manufacturer Part Number
AD7225LR
Manufacturer
Analog Devices
Introduction
AD7225LR is an 8-bit quad digital-to-analog converter featuring high-speed performance and low power consumption.
Product Features and Performance
8-bit resolution
Four D/A converters integrated
Fast settling time of 4µs
Buffered voltage output
Parallel data interface for simple digital interaction
External reference input for flexible range setting
R-2R ladder architecture for precision and reliability
Surface mount 24-SOIC package for compact board design
Wide operating temperature range from -40°C to 85°C

Key Technical Parameters
Number of Bits: 8
Number of D/A Converters: 4
Settling Time: 4µs
Output Type: Voltage - Buffered
Data Interface: Parallel
Reference Type: External
Voltage Supply, Analog: 11.4V to 16.5V, -5V
Voltage Supply, Digital: 14.25V to 15.75V
INL/DNL (LSB): ±0.5 (Max), ±1 (Max)
Architecture: R-2R
Operating Temperature: -40°C to 85°C

Product Lifecycle
Obsolete status - Not recommended for new designs
Substitutes or upgrade paths may be available from Analog Devices
